Bathroom Drain Installation in Denver, CO

Bathroom drain installation services involve setting up or replacing the drainage systems that carry wastewater away from sinks, tubs, showers, and other fixtures within a bathroom. This service covers a variety of projects, including new bathroom renovations, upgrades to existing plumbing, and repairs for drainage issues. Homeowners often seek these services to ensure proper function, prevent leaks, and improve overall bathroom hygiene by installing efficient and reliable drainage systems that meet the specific layout and needs of their property.

Before requesting bathroom drain installation, property owners typically want to understand the scope of work involved, including the types of materials used, compatibility with existing plumbing, and any necessary modifications to the bathroom layout. It’s also helpful to clarify whether the project involves installing new drains in a remodel or replacing outdated or damaged piping. Having a clear idea of the project’s requirements can facilitate a smoother process and ensure the installed drainage system functions effectively for years to come.

Bathroom Drain Installation Questions

What types of bathroom drain installation services are available? Services include installing new drains for sinks, showers, tubs, and replacing existing drain lines to improve flow and prevent leaks.

How can I tell if my bathroom drain needs replacement? Signs include frequent clogs, slow drainage, foul odors, or visible damage to the drain or pipes.

What materials are used for bathroom drain installations? Common materials include PVC, ABS, and metal piping, selected based on durability and compatibility with existing plumbing.

Are there different drain options for various bathroom fixtures? Yes, options vary for sinks, showers, tubs, and floor drains, each designed to meet specific drainage needs and code requirements.
